DESCRIPTION AND OPERATION
The Globe Quick Response GL Series Sprinklers are a
low profile yet durable design which utilizes a 3mm frangible glass
ampule as the thermosensitive element. This provides sprinkler
operation approximately six times faster than ordinary sprinklers.
While the Quick Response Sprinkler provides an aesthetically
pleasing appearance, it can be installed wherever standard spray
sprinklers are specified when allowed by the applicable stan-
dards. It offers the additional feature of greatly increased safe-
ty to life and is available in various styles, orifices, temperature
ratings and finishes to meet many varying design requirements.
Quick Response Sprinklers should be used advisedly and under
the direction of approving authorities having jurisdiction.
The heart of Globe's GL Series sprinkler proven actuat-
ing assembly is a hermetically sealed frangible glass ampule that
contains a precisely measured amount of fluid. When heat is ab-
sorbed, the liquid within the bulb expands increasing the internal
pressure. At the prescribed temperature the internal pressure
within the ampule exceeds the strength of the glass causing the
glass to shatter. This results in water discharge which is distrib-
uted in an approved pattern depending upon the deflector style
used.

NFPA 136: E LANGUAGE & SEISMIC QUALIFICATION
NFPA 13 STANDARD FOR INSTALLATION OF SPRINKLER SYSTEMS 2016 EDITION
9.2.1.3.3 Flexible° Sprinkler Hose Fittings.
9.2.1.3.3.1 Listed flexible sprinkler hose fittings and their anchoring components intended for use in installations
connecting the sprinkler system piping to sprinklers shall be installed in accordance with the requirements
of the listing, including any installation instructions.
9.2.1.3.3.2 When installed and supported by suspended ceilings, the ceiling shall meet ASTM C 635, Standard
Specification for the Manufacture, Performance, and Testing of Metal Suspension Systems for
Acoustical Tile and Lay -In Panel Ceilings, and shall be installed in accordance with ASTM C 636,
Standard Practice for Installation of Metal Ceiling Suspension Systems for Acoustical Tile and
Lay -In Panels.
9.2.1.3.3.3 When flexible sprinkler hose fittings exceed 6 ft (1.83 m) in length and are supported by a suspended
ceiling in accordance with 9.2.1.3.3.2, a hanger(s) attached to the structure shall be required to ensure
that the maximum unsupported length does not exceed 6 ft. (1.83 m),
9.2.1.3.3.4 Where flexible sprinkler hose fittings are used to connect sprinklers to branch lines in suspended ceilings,
a label limiting relocation of the sprinkler shall be provided on the anchoring component.
A. 9.2.1.3.3.3 The committee evaluation of flexible sprinkler hose fittings supported by suspended ceilings was based
on a comparison of the weight of a 6 ft, 1 in (1.8 m) diameter Schedule 40 water -filled unsupported
arrnover weighing approximately 13 Ib (5.9 kg) to the weight of a 6 ft, 1 in. (1.8 m) diameter water -filled
flexible hose fitting weighing approximately 9 Ib (4.1 kg). The information provided to the committee
showed that the maximum Toad shed to the suspended ceiling by the flexible hose fitting was
approximately 6 Ib (2.7 kg) and that a suspended ceiling meeting ASTM C 635, Standard Specification
for the Manufacture, Performance, and Testing of Metal Suspension Systems of Acoustical 171e and
Lay -In Panel Ceilings, and installed in accordance with ASTM C 636, Standard Practice for
Installation of Metal Ceiling Suspension Systems for Acoustical Tile and Lay -In Panels, can
substantially support that load. In addition, the supporting material showed that the flexible hose
connection can be attached to the suspended ceilings because it allow the necessary deflections under
seismic conditions.
A.9.2.1.3.3.4 An example of language for the label is as follows:
CAUTION: DO NOT REMOVE THIS LABEL.
Relocation of this device should only be performed by qualified and/or licensed individuals that are aware
of the original system design criteria, hydraulic criteria, sprinkler head listing parameters, and knowledge
of the state and local codes including NFPA 13 installation standards. Relocation of the device without
this knowledge could adversely affect the performance of this fire protection and life safety system,

FlexHead® Industries recently satisfactorily completed full-scale seismic qualification testing at the Structural
Engineering Earthquake Simulation Laboratory located at the State University of New York at Buffalo. Tests were
conducted using the International Code Council (ICC) acceptance criteria "ICC-ES AC-156 Seismic Qualification
Testing of Nonstructural Components".
• More than 90°/0 of the states in the U.S. are adopting the
International Building Code (IBC) that address, among
other things, the installation of fre sprinkler systems in
seismic zones.
• The latest version of the IBC defers to ASCE 7 for the
sprinkler/ceiling design in Seismic Design Categories
9SDC) C and D, E & F.
• In Seismic Design Category C, suspended ceilings are to
be designed and installed in accordance with Ceilings &
Interior Systems Construction Association (CISCA)
recommendations for Zones 0-2; and sprinkler heads
and other penetrations shall have a minimum of 'A inch
clearance on all sides.
• In Seismic Design Categories D, E & F, suspended
ceilings are to be designed and installed in accordance
with CISCA recommendations for seismic Zones 3 and 4
with some additional requirements. Except where rigid
braces are used to limit lateral deflections, sprinkler heads
and other penetrations shall have a 2-inch oversized ring,
sleeve, or adapter through the ceiling to allow for free
movement of at least 1 inch of ceiling movement in all
horizontal directions.
■ Flexible sprinkler connection provide characteristics that
exceed the most stringent seismic code requirements.
The flexibility of the hose allows the head to move with
the ceiling in any direction during a seismic event without
causing damage to the sprinkler system.

CAST IRON THREADED FITTINGS D A!L.
General Assembly of Threaded Fittings
1)
Inspect both male and female components prior to assembly.
• Threads should be free from mechanical damage, dirt, chips and excess cutting oil.
• Clean or replace components as necessary.
2) Application of thread sealant
• Use a thread sealant that is fast drying, sets -up to a semi hard condition and is vibration resistant. Alternately, an anaerobic
sealant may be utilized.
• Thoroughly mix the thread sealant prior to application.
• Apply a thick even coat to the male threads only. Best application is achieved with a brush stiff enough to force sealant down
to the root of the threads.
3) Joint Makeup
• For sizes up to and including 2" pipe, wrench tight makeup is considered three full turns past handtight. Handtight engagement
for'/t" through 2" thread varies from 4/2 turns to 5 turns.
• For 21/: through 4" sizes, wrench tight makeup is considered two full turns past handtight. Handtight engagement for 21/2"
through 4" thread varies from turns to 6'/eturns.
